There was a problem hiding this comment.
Add an explicit “all expected models were present” assertion.
Right now this loop validates known IDs but can still pass if one expected model is missing from data.

@mostlygeek - What are your thoughts on llamaswap exposing the configured model context size (if detected) (and potentially other information?) on the /models endpoint?
The problem right now is that as far as I can tell the only way to get model configuration information is by querying the upstream server, which means the upstream server has to start and load the model, then passing that information with some middleware e.g
https://llamaswap.your.domain/upstream/<model_name>/slotsThe reason this would be useful is that this would allow clients to properly configure their settings to the models configured context window (and potentially other parameters).
This change would have /v1/models endpoint would return:
This is roughly in line with what many model providers such as OpenRouter and LLM proxies such as Bifrost (
